Thrive Homes and Watford Community Housing to become Chime Housing on 1 June 2026

 

Thrive Homes Finance Plc

£200,000,000 4.68 per cent. Secured Bonds due 2051

 

13th May 2026

 

Thrive Homes and Watford Community Housing have announced they will become Chime Housing when the two organisations merge on 1 June 2026. This new Community Gateway housing association will own and manage more than 13,500 homes in Hertfordshire and the surrounding areas.
